Best Quotes about Lies and lying

1.
Who does not in some sort live to others, does not live much to himself.
Montaigne, Michel Eyquem De

2.

3.
That's not a lie, it's a terminological inexactitude. Also, a tactical misrepresentation.
Haig, Alexander

4.
There is nothing in the world more shameful than establishing one's self on lies and fables.
Goethe, Johann Wolfgang Von

5.
A lie will easily get you out of a scrape, and yet, strangely and beautifully, rapture possesses you when you have taken the scrape and left out the lie.
Montague, C. E.

6.
I detest the man who hides one thing in the depth of his heart and speaks forth another.
Homer

7.
It is sometimes necessary to lie damnably in the interests of the nation.
Belloc, Hilaire

8.
Never chase a lie. Let it alone, and it will run itself to death. I can work out a good character much faster than anyone can lie me out of it
Beecher, Lyman

9.
To the rulers of the state then, if to any, it belongs of right to use falsehood, to deceive either enemies or their own citizens, for the good of the state: and no one else may meddle with this privilege.
Plato

10.
Each day a few more lies eat into the seed with which we are born, little institutional lies from the print of newspapers, the shock waves of television, and the sentimental cheats of the movie screen.
Mailer, Norman

11.
What does the truth matter? Haven't we mothers all given our sons a taste for lies, lies which from the cradle upwards lull them, reassure them, send them to sleep: lies as soft and warm as a breast!
Bernanos, Georges

12.
No man lies so boldly as the man who is indignant.
Nietzsche, Friedrich

13.
This is the punishment of a liar: he is not believed, even when he speaks the truth.
Talmud, The

14.
If you want to be thought a liar, always tell the truth.
Smith, Logan Pearsall

15.
Telling lies is a fault in a boy, an art in a lover, an accomplishment in a bachelor, and second-nature in a married man.
Rowland, Helen

16.
Someone who knows too much finds it hard not to lie.
Wittgenstein, Ludwig

17.

18.
We lie loudest when we lie to ourselves.
Hoffer, Eric

19.
Good lies need a leavening of truth to make them palatable.
Mcilvanney, William

20.
And, after all, what is a lie? 'Tis but the truth in masquerade.
Byron, Lord

21.
Lying is like alcoholism. You are always recovering.
Soderbergh, Steven

22.
As one knows the poet by his fine music, so one can recognize the liar by his rich rhythmic utterance, and in neither case will the casual inspiration of the moment suffice. Here, as elsewhere, practice must precede perfection.
Wilde, Oscar

23.
Some lies are so well disguised to resemble truth, that we should be poor judges of the truth not to believe them.

24.
Pain forces even the innocent to lie.
Syrus, Publilius

25.
Lying and stealing are next door neighbors.
Proverb, Arabian

26.
In human relationships, kindness and lies are worth a thousand truths.
Greene, Graham

27.
So near is falsehood to truth that a wise man would do well not to trust himself on the narrow edge.
Cicero, Marcus T.

28.
There are a terrible lot of lies going about the world, and the worst of it is that half of them are true.
Churchill, Winston

29.
Liars are the cause of all the sins and crimes in the world.
Epictetus

30.

31.
When a man lies, he murders some part of the world.
Merlin

32.
With lies you may go ahead in the world, but you can never go back.
Proverb, Russian

33.
I do myself a greater injury in lying that I do him of whom I tell a lie.
Montaigne, Michel Eyquem De

34.
The truth that survives is simply the lie that is pleasantest to believe.
Mencken, H. L.

35.
If you do not wish to be lied to, do not ask questions. If there were no questions, there would be no lies.
Traven, B.

36.
Lying is an indispensable part of making life tolerable.
Evans

37.
It is easier to gather up a bag of loose feathers than to round up or head off a single lie.

38.
Don't lie if you don't have to.
Szilard, Leo

39.
Don't join the book burners. Do not think you are going to conceal thoughts by concealing evidence that they ever existed.
Eisenhower, Dwight D.

40.
Someone who always has to lie discovers that every one of his lies is true.
Canetti, Elias

41.
Time passes, and little by little everything that we have spoken in falsehood becomes true.
Proust, Marcel

42.
Falsehood is invariably the child of fear in one form or another.
Crowley, Aleister

43.
He entered the territory of lies without a passport for return.
Greene, Graham

44.
Never to lie is to have no lock to your door, you are never wholly alone.
Bowen, Elizabeth

45.
A wise man does not waste so good a commodity as lying for naught.
Twain, Mark

46.
The liar at any rate recognizes that recreation, not instruction, is the aim of conversation, and is a far more civilized being than the blockhead who loudly expresses his disbelief in a story which is told simply for the amusement of the company.
Wilde, Oscar

47.
They say is often a great liar.
Proverb

48.
All lies and jests, still a man hears what he wants to hear and disregards the rest.
Simon, Paul

49.
I would dodge, not lie, in the national interest.
Speakes, Larry

50.
Lies are essential to humanity. They are perhaps as important as the pursuit of pleasure and moreover are dictated by that pursuit.
Proust, Marcel
